    Pi

    The main character is an unemployed mathematician with schizoid personality disorder whose social interactions are mostly with his old professor and the people in his apartment building. The movie is a thriller, but the main character’s isolation from the rest of the world is rather stark. This is helped by the fact that it was filmed in high-contrast black and white.
